'Once upon a dough' was set up in my current university as a non-profit project for Women Farmers in India. They struggle daily for low income which affect directly their standard of living. For this reason, 'Once upon a Dough' intervenes to give them the chance to make cotton Dough which means 'cloud' in the Marathi (local dialect). By donating either £1 / €1 / $1 you will receive the Dough and you will help Women Farmers to enhance their livelihood. 100% of the donation we receive will be sent to the Indian Community for supporting the project.
